Hans Holbein the Younger 1497-1543 was born in Augsburg Bavaria. He received his first lessons in art from his father. In 1515 the younger Holbein went to Basel Switzerland with his brother Ambrosius. Among the many scholars living in Basel at that time was the famous Dutch humanist Erasmus who befriended the young artist and asked him to illustrate his satire Encomium Moriae The Praise of Folly. Holbein also illustrated other books including Martin Luther's German translation of the Bible. In addition he painted pictures and portraits and like his father designed stained-glass windows. He also created designs for a series of 41 woodcuts called The Dance of Death. About 1525 the factional strife that accompanied the Reformation made Basel a difficult place for an artist to work. In 1526 Holbein carrying a letter of introduction from Erasmus to the English statesman and author Sir Thomas More set out for London. He met with a favorable reception in England and stayed there for two years. In 1528 he returned to Basel where he painted portraits and murals for the town hall. In 1532 he left his wife and children there and traveled once again to London. In England where he became court painter to Henry VIII Holbein was known chiefly as a painter of portraits. His services were much in demand. The more than 100 miniature and full-size portraits he completed at Henry's court provide a remarkable document of that colorful period. An old account of his services at court relates that he painted the portrait of the king "life size so well that everyone who looks is astonished since it seems to live as if it moved its head and limbs." In spite of their richness of detail Holbein's portraits provide remarkably little insight into the personality and character of the people he painted. Holbein also found time to perform numerous services for Henry. He designed the king's state robes and made drawings that were the basis of all kinds of items used by the royal household from buttons to bridles to bookbindings. In 1539 when Henry was thinking of marrying Anne of Cleves he sent Holbein to paint her portrait. About The Author: Thomas Holbein Hendley 1847-1917 was a British physician and amateur ethnographer who worked in India during the British Raj. Hendley is best known for his contributions to the study of Indian arts crafts and medicine particularly through his seminal works like ""Memorials of the Jeypore Exhibition 1883"" and ""Asian Carpets."" His writings and collections played a significant role in documenting and promoting Indian cultural heritage offering invaluable insights into the traditional practices and artistic expressions of the time. W. Griggs 1832-1911 was a distinguished English photolithographer and printer renowned for his pioneering work in color reproduction techniques. His innovative methods in chromolithography greatly advanced the field particularly in the accurate replication of artworks and archaeological illustrations. Griggs' contributions were instrumental in the dissemination of detailed and color-accurate images enhancing the accessibility and study of historical and cultural materials. His work remains a significant milestone in the development of photographic and printing technologies. About The Book: ""General Medical History of Rajputana"" by Colonel Thomas Holbein Hendley is a detailed account of the medical practices health conditions and diseases prevalent in the Rajputana region modern-day Rajasthan India during the British colonial period. Published in the late 19th century Hendley a British medical officer meticulously documented the traditional and contemporary medical practices public health challenges and the impact of British interventions. His work provides valuable insights into the medical history of the region and the intersection of indigenous and colonial health practices. About The Author: Colonel Thomas Holbein Hendley 1847-1917 was a British medical officer and author known for his work in India. He served in Rajasthan documenting its medical history and practices. Hendley also contributed to the preservation of Indian art and culture notably through his involvement in establishing the Jaipur Museum.
